Solutions Architect

The Solutions Architect / Client Manager is a highly visible, strategic/tactical role that requires business acumen, technical creatively, and experience with web/on-demand services. It’s an ideal position to gain invaluable experience in different facets of an organization (service delivery, sales and business development, marketing, product management, etc).

We’re looking for someone who shares our beliefs and is willing to do what it takes for us to be successful. We currently have a very small consulting team, and this is a key hire for us since we're looking to build our team around this individual. We're also open to hiring a more experienced individual at a Director level.

At a very high level, we envision that you will have responsibilities in some of the following areas. We do realize these are wide ranging responsibilities, and envision the role will be more focused on specific areas in time.

  • Solutions Architect
    • Work independently, or as part of a team to utilize your industry experience and creativity in crafting solutions that address different types of opportunities.
    • Market and sell existing products/solutions from our portfolio.
  • Client Manager
    • We practice a very light project management methodology based on milestones. You will manage a small set of projects including coordination between the client, business analysts, and developers.
    • Eventually grow into owning a specific practice or vertical such as e-commerce.
  • Other
    • Develop and maintain marketing collateral, power point presentations, etc, for our services and solutions.
    • Be the voice of the customer internally, helping shape our products and how they are delivered.
    • Determine the optimal way to position products in the market.
    • Find new markets and verticals to expand our products and services to.

Ideal Candidate (Qualifications):

  • Must have at least five years of combined industry experience in at least one of the following areas: enterprise software implementation, project management, business development, or business process consulting.
  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Engineering, Information Systems or other related disciplines. MBA is preferred.
  • A technical background is preferred but not necessary—we’re not looking for someone to code, but some who understands technology well, and can speak credibly on it at a high-level. Understanding of integration technologies such as SOA and Web Services is a bonus.
  • Prior experience with CRM/ERP systems is preferred.
  • Prior experience in On-Demand applications is a bonus.
  • Formal project management experience is a bonus. Experience in managing teams is a plus.
  • Prior experience/involvement in sales is preferred.
  • Must have experience working with external clients.
  • Must be creative. Must be passionate about building great products. We urge and empower our team to think big and bring their ideas to the table to make us a better company.
  • We like to see an overriding ambition and proactive nature, combined with the ability to inspire others.
  • Must enjoy working at a start-up, including having a start-up mind set, flexible with shifting priorities, and an attitude and passion for results.
  • Ability to handle a variety of different projects simultaneously, and capable of managing multiple deadlines. Ability to take direction and work independently.

Java Developer

We're looking for a couple of highly talented junior developers who are either straight out of college or have one to two years of experience. Please note that this is a full-time position.

The ideal candidate for this position should be passionate about coding, designing applications, working directly with customers, willing to take the initiative, and exploring the vast number of open source technologies on the market. This position is an excellent starting point for almost any career in the high tech industry. Not only will you get to work in cutting edge technology, but as a member of a small team, you will be exposed to different facets of the business, and get to wear different hats.

Specifically, you will be doing most of your development in Java, with a focus on consuming Web Services, utilizing enterprise service bus (ESB) technologies, core development in Spring, web application development using established frameworks such as Struts and Spring MVC, etc.

Your job responsibilities will include building add-on products on top of the native web services and implementing custom projects to extend and integrate on-demand services with other enterprise applications.

Qualifications:

  • Strong experience in Java.
  • Good understanding of object orientated methodologies and design patterns.
  • Experience with XML a plus.
  • Experience with Web Services a plus.
  • Experience with Microsoft .NET is a plus.
  • Strong organizational skills including task prioritization, time management, and risk identification and mitigation.
  • Ability to take the initiative, and thrive in a fast paced environment.
  • Thorough understanding of product/project workflow processes including requirements gathering and use cases, analysis & design, implementation, testing, and deployment.
